At Punchcard, we’re in the process of inventing a new type of consulting agency, and we need great people to come along this journey with us. Our clients come to us to help them solve interesting challenges using technology. We’re scaling our team and are looking for a Digital Workplace Practice Lead (DWPL) to support the strategic development of the incredible platforms we build for our clients.
Reporting to the Technical Partner, the DWPL will hold a key role in developing and growing the digital workplace practice within Punchcard, working with clients to create and transform their digital workplaces using Microsoft 365 solution sets. The DWPL will function as a technical lead on assigned projects, provide researched strategy guidance, align the project with business requirements, scope and budget, implement solutions, and train and support end users.

**What we need you to do**:
In the course of your work, you’ll use different skills to advance your projects:

- Service Design & Strategy:

- Conduct user interviews towards the goal of innovative and usable solutions;
- Design facilitation workshops with clients;
- Create service designs with project stakeholders that detail project requirements and deliverables; and
- Define project documentation including design, build and operations guides, as well as the management processes and procedures.
- Business Analysis:

- Ensure solutions adequately address business requirements and align with existing or proposed business processes;
- Create stakeholder and delivery team alignment through well executed requirements that maintain disciplined project scope; and
- Develop and present process roadmaps.
- Implementation:

- Oversee the content migration into SharePoint sites with migration tools or manual procedures;
- Perform testing of SharePoint and Teams sites or components throughout set up and migration;
- Develop user guides and training material for various aspects of the SharePoint and Teams administration; and
- Provide training and workshops for clients and stakeholders.
- Support:

- Manage incoming support requests related to SharePoint and Teams administration;
- Provide technical support for SharePoint users; and
- Delegate work to development teams where needed.
- Additional Skills:

- Assist in the sales and development roles from a technical perspective, through demos, presentations, and workshops; and
- Keep abreast of relevant industry certifications and accreditations as aligned with key practices and technology partners.

**Skills we expect you to bring**:

- Demonstrate specific knowledge of the function and makeup of Microsoft SharePoint and Teams
-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field required
- Experience growing a practice
- Experience managing a team is a plus.
- A demonstrated ability to pitch and present new product ideas and change in product/process strategy to senior management.
- Microsoft Certifications will be beneficial e.g. Microsoft 365 Certified: Teamwork Administrator Associate
- Experience in Microsoft Power BI, Tableau or similar products is an asset.
- Experience using migration tools as well as custom scripts to migrate and populate content into SharePoint
- Experience with SharePoint migration and governance platforms, like AvePoint or Orchestry, is a plus
- Strong interpersonal skills to work collaboratively with a wide range of clients, both internal and external, from technical to non-technical, including presentation skills and technical documentation
- Strong organizational skills with a proven ability to successfully manage multiple responsibilities
- Strong attention to detail and a commitment to follow-through
- Background in startup desirable.
